Sony commercialised the first lithium-ion rechargeable battery cell in 1991. Thirty-four years later, cell development is still locked in cycles of trial and error. Iterations happen in laboratories. R&D lines, testing, data processing, and communicating results all take months for a single loop.

Critical data and expertise remain behind supplier walls and silo-ed teams. And if you are buying cells from a supplier, you are often a passenger in the process, watching from the side lines as choices are made that will define your product’s performance for years.

Virtual cells, real decisions

Breathe Design is a digital cell design tool built for speed, clarity, and control.
Through a simple, easy-to-use interface, it lets your team run complex simulations in the time it takes to make a coffee.

You can change electrode composition and thickness, tweak porosity, adjust the N/P ratio, or explore new form factors, and instantly predict the resulting performance. Imagine seeing a clear before-and-after, parameters adjusted, KPIs shifting, insights appearing in real time.

These performance metrics tell part of the story. Breathe Design can also generate physics-based cell models from your virtual designs. This enables dynamic simulations to predict performance in real-world scenarios, such as fast charging, heat generation under heavy load, and runtime during demanding duty cycles.

What we are most excited about is how these virtual cells integrate into pack and system-level simulations. You can explore hundreds of scenarios without building a single prototype, adjust design parameters, generate a cell model, and simulate system performance in minutes. This creates a connected workflow where system and cell design happen together, not in isolation.
